This is a low-angle, full-shot photograph of the Great Elephant of Nantes, an enormous mechanical elephant sculpture located in the Machines de l'île park in Nantes, France. The elephant, constructed from wood and metal, is shown from its head down to its legs. Its large, carved wooden head features realistic detailing, including visible eye sockets and a prominent, light-colored tusk. The elephant's trunk is curled downwards and to the left, with mechanical linkages visible beneath its segmented, wooden skin. Decorative, dark metal plates with rivet details adorn the area around its ears. The elephant stands within a vast, glass-roofed industrial-style structure with visible metal beams and supports overhead, suggesting it is housed indoors in a large exhibition space or workshop. Below the elephant's head and body, structural supports, mechanical components, and a small control booth with wooden-framed windows are visible. A balcony or platform area with decorative wooden elements can be seen to the right of the elephant's head. The overall impression is of a massive, intricate, and functional piece of kinetic art within an expansive industrial setting.
